A group of us had a space in Seattle and the cost ended up being $150 / month / person. That got us maybe 2000 sq feet of basement space. People used it as a project space, party space, and work space.

I think a few things in particular made it work: - A bunch of people who wanted to work on projects together and could come down for weekly meetings. - A few people willing to take on administrative responsibilities (collecting rent, thinking about organizational structure, etc). - The cool-factor of having a hacker space (there weren't many others at that point)

We eventually closed it down when everyone's lives got busy but it was a great run.
